History & Origin

Miel comes from French and Spanish miel, 'honey' (from Latin mel). A soft, sweet word-name, it carries golden warmth and is used affectionately across Romance-language cultures.

It registers thinly in records. Rare, honey at the root, and tender.

Did you know? Miel means 'honey' in both French and Spanish (from Latin mel) — a sweet term of endearment that makes a delicate, golden name.

Frequently Asked

What does the name Miel mean?

Miel is French and Spanish for 'honey', from Latin mel.

How do you pronounce Miel?

It's said mee-EL /miˈɛl/ — two syllables, stress on the second.

Is Miel a boy or girl name?

Miel is a girl's name.

How popular is Miel?

Miel is a rare name in the U.S.
